I need to get to the Enable VGA mode when I boot the computer, since I never
made it with F8 then I set up the save mode via the MsConfig and then when
re-boot windows goes into save mode. But this time I need to see several
options before I go further and choose if it save mode Enable VGA etc..

I am using Windows XP SP2 and Pentium 4, 3.6 GHZ cpu.

Which option set it up in the Boot.ini table in the MsConfig?

The /basevideo switch in boot.ini forces 640x480 VGA mode.
